Silton Cardoso

Description
Silton Cardoso was a Brazilian actor and voice actor, born in Minas Gerais on November 28, 1938. He passed away on July 5, 2014, in São Paulo. While he had a career in theater, he became widely recognized for his extensive work in dubbing, particularly for television series and films.

In the realm of anime and animation, Cardoso contributed his voice to several projects. He is credited with the role of Ringo in the Brazilian dubbing of the anime OVA Leda - The Fantastic Adventure of Yohko, known in Portuguese as As Aventuras de Leda. Additionally, his anime dubbing work included providing voices for characters in the film Vampire Hunter D, where he voiced both Conde Magnus Lee and the Left Hand of D.

Despite these roles, Cardoso's most prominent and enduring legacy in dubbing was for live-action series. He was the first and most recognized Brazilian voice for the character Godinez, played by Mexican actor Horácio Gómez Bolaños, in the popular sitcoms Chaves (El Chavo del Ocho) and Chapolin (El Chapulín Colorado). He voiced Godinez and other characters portrayed by the same actor for many years. After a period away from dubbing due to personal matters, he returned in 2012 to reprise the role of Godinez for newly dubbed episodes of Chaves, which were broadcast in early 2014. His final works in dubbing were completed during this period.
